Taxonomic Classification

Rank Black-eared Red-backed Vole Needle Rust
Kingdom Animalia (Animals) Fungi (Fungi)
Phylum Chordata (Chordates) Basidiomycota (Club Fungi)
Class Mammalia (Mammals) Pucciniomycetes (Pucciniomycetes)
Order Rodentia (Rodents) Pucciniales (Pucciniales)
Family Cricetidae Coleosporiaceae
Genus Eothenomys Chrysomyxa
Species Eothenomys olitor Chrysomyxa ledi
